About the Audemars Piguet 15553BA.OO.1356BA.04
The Audemars Piguet Royal Oak Selfwinding 15553BA.OO.1356BA.04 debuted in 2026 and applies the combination of an 18-carat yellow-gold case and a natural malachite stone dial to the 37 mm Royal Oak format.
The watch is housed in a 37 mm case crafted from 18-carat yellow gold with a thickness of 9.3 mm. Glareproofed sapphire crystals are fitted on both the dial side and the caseback. Water resistance is rated to 50 metres. The integrated bracelet is executed in matching yellow gold and secured by a three-blade folding clasp.
The dial is produced from natural malachite, displaying banded stone patterns that vary from one example to another. It is fitted with 18-carat yellow-gold hands and hour markers filled with luminescent material and framed by a yellow-gold-toned inner bezel. The display is limited to hours, minutes, and central seconds.
Powering the watch is the selfwinding Calibre 5909. The movement operates at a frequency of 28,800 vibrations per hour (4 Hz), consists of 174 components, contains 29 jewels, measures 26.2 mm in diameter with a thickness of 3.9 mm, and provides a power reserve of approximately 60 hours.
